Output efe1016f5aaa026335acdf8aa1a922993e1edbc01f5a400278ee954daba20658:1

value
1096740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0a1e0f43991a976c4764dcd1be46e14884f3a8 OP_EQUAL
address
3MkUhiYiKBDdNxcpYbrWYYpNbEAivNLMvZ
transaction
efe1016f5aaa026335acdf8aa1a922993e1edbc01f5a400278ee954daba20658
confirmations
314045
spent
true